оз. Бобрица залив / Bay of Bobritsa lake

Dive into the pristine waters of a beautiful lake in Belarus. Explore a thriving underwater ecosystem teeming with pike, perch, tench, rudd, bleak, and various other species of lake fish. As you venture deeper, you may even encounter crayfish hiding among the fallen tree debris. With a visibility of 3 meters and a maximum depth of 9 meters, this dive site offers a fantastic opportunity for both beginner and advanced divers. Located in Боровский сельский Совет, Lepiel District, Vitsebsk Region, this captivating dive spot is a hidden gem waiting to be explored by underwater enthusiasts.
